Dive into the warm and bustling charm of Jimmy’s Coffee on Royal York Road, a true local favorite in Toronto's Etobicoke district. This inviting café captivates with its sunshine-yellow stripe awnings, casually vibrant sidewalk seating, and the rich aroma of freshly brewed coffee seeping through its classic wooden-framed windows. Watch as locals savor laid-back moments amid candid conversations and the gentle hum of city life. Perfect for those chasing authentic urban coffee culture, Jimmy’s Coffee offers a soul-soothing retreat where every sip feels like a warm embrace.
